OPSEC - Navy Operations Security

Always keep Navy Operations Security in mind.  In the Navy, it's essential to remember that "loose lips sink ships."  OPSEC is everyone's responsibility. 

DON'T post critical information including future destinations or ports of call; future operations, exercises or missions; deployment or homecoming dates.  

DO be smart, use your head, always think OPSEC when using texts, email, phone, and social media, and watch this video: "Importance of Navy OPSEC."

MrsB: The shuttles are able to go AROUND the line of cars....so not sure what you heard is correct (we took the shuttle and it was wonderful!). We left our hotel at 6:30 (our PIR had 9 divisions in it---yours has 10), arrived at the front gate at 6:40, were the second people to be searched at the front gate (first people were on our shuttle) and were in the PIR Hall by 7 a.m. It is a matter of personal choice on whether to take the shuttle or not. But it was the dead of winter when we went, and we were advised by friends who went the same time a year earlier to take the shuttle rather than waiting in the car line. There are pros and cons to doing either. I would take the shuttle again for sure!
The longer walk is not by much at all.
For those who drive, you need to be in line by 6:15 at latest. Not sure where that forms...I know they don't allow it by the front gate and actually turned some people away who were there too early (another reason for the shuttle!). But you all have 10 divisions, which is a good number of people. I would not wait until 6:30 to be driving there. I think you may have a line by then.
